Honeywell announces winners of its 2011 Channel Partner of the Year awards

Honeywell today announced the winners of its annual Channel Partner of the Year awards at the 2011 Americas Distribution Channel Executive Conference, being held in conjunction with Honeywell's flagship annual Americas Users Group Symposium.

The awards recognize Honeywell Process Solutions' channel partners in the Americas region who have performed exceptionally throughout the last 12 months, meeting key criteria including growth, customer service, innovation and excellence in the “spirit of partnership.” Awards are given to one partner from North America, and one from South America.

Honeywell's channel partners distribute products and solutions related to instrumentation, modular controllers, and Honeywell Enraf products and solutions relating to tank gauging, tank inventory management, tank terminal operations and meter proving. The awards were presented by Don Maness, vice president and general manager of field products, Honeywell Process Solutions, and Richard Thompson, general manager, Honeywell Enraf. The two winners were:

1. North America: Loy Instrument, Inc (United States). Accepting the award was Ken Bradway, vice president and engineering manager.

2. South America: Equipos y Controles Industriales S.A (Colombia). Accepting the award was Javier Lozano Gomez, sales manager.

“Our channel partners are a very important part of the Honeywell business, as they really bring great value to customers across many industries. With their local knowledge and product expertise they can help customers meet local regulatory and industrial process requirements, which is a huge help in our industry,” Maness said. “We wanted to recognize the role they play in the success of our business, and these awards are our way of saying thank you.”

“I'm really happy to accept this award because we believe in the products and solutions that Honeywell makes,” Bradway said. “Working with the Honeywell team means we can offer quality products to our customers while counting on great support and help at all times. It's a great combination.”
